Output 6604ecd94cd27b7d788c7c63325f5d2cb7ebdb266ec04ca9c2762820c389d157:0

value
8105312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6faeae2a4f876ebb44eb9eb42bc44a8b495efd0a OP_EQUAL
address
3BsYBqdVZ9d6PLLBz3wy5tEdLHyirVBjLo
transaction
6604ecd94cd27b7d788c7c63325f5d2cb7ebdb266ec04ca9c2762820c389d157
spent
true